Social Media Page Sketch (initial ideas)

 


Social Media Page - Paper Sketch

Choice of platform: Instagram  
Account Status: Public
Management: A mix between Lyn and media management.


The avatar is mostly chosen through observation of Gracie Abrams's profile picture. With a close-up image of the artist's facial features, the viewers may recognize them more easily; therefore, Lyn has her face very largely zoomed in. 
The username "LaLaLyn" is inspired by the iconic motion picture "La La Land". However, the official name may be changed since there are countless Instagram accounts, which means it is very likely that the name has already been taken. The fact that Lyn is a celebrity and is presumed to be quite active on the platform herself as an artist who likes to interact semi-directly with her audience, it is only reasonable for Lyn to have the blue tick - the verification badge which indicates that Instagram confirms the account as an authentic presence of a notable public figure, celebrity, brand, or creator. Like how Billie Eilish and Gracie Abrams's Instagram pages include promotional biography sections, Lyn's will have the name of her newest album, "Poetry", in the same place, followed by the similar "out now" phrase, stimulating interest from viewers. ✮⋆˙

    Of all the statistics included, I believe the most important to focus on is the number of followers, as it would reflect the impact or level of fame someone has. While sketching, my view of the public awareness of Lyn is somewhat strong, but not too overwhelming. However, as I am looking back, I believe her recognition should reach much further than a couple of hundred thousand; therefore, I'd like to state her followers as around 2 million.  ִֶָ۶ৎ˖ִ ˚



     
 



Although neither Billie Eilish nor Gracie Abrams's Instagram feeds include highlights, I believe they are worth the curation, as it takes very minimal effort to set up, and could give the social media user a very quick and convenient look into Lyn's career: shows, interviews, collaborations, etc. For LaLaLyn, I added 2 highlights, each of the geographical region of her tour for the "Poetry" album. ᯓᡣ𐭩

  About the posts, which arguably are the most important part of the social media website, there will be a variety of content. Firstly, there will be pictures of her daily life, published in the form of random "photodumps" (a collection of random photography - could be of things, people, or events) - her breakfast and/or outfits. In between those are campaign photoshoots for "Poetry", along with some Magazine collaborations. There is also behind-the-scenes footage edited in trailer format of the making of "I Told You Things" (title track of the album)૮ • ﻌ - ა

Digipak Planning



DIGIPAK BRAINSTORMING AND SKETCH

    The idea was to transfer the theme of the "Poetry" album moodboard into the visual presentation of the digipak, ensuring a sense of coordination in the overall aesthetic of the project to uphold Lyn's representation in the public eye. It was quite difficult initially to decide whether to include more inner sleeve content within the digipak, with 2 extra pages, along with the CD, or to keep it simpler with a conventional 4-page digipak, which comprises only 1 extra page. Ultimately, I decided to go on the more demanding route; though it requires more time and designing work, it allows for more space for creativity, where Lyn's artistry can be showcased even further. 

1. FRONT COVER

Inspired by the original artist Gracie Abrams herself, the use of a Polaroid photo can evoke a sense of intimacy and personalisation, as it is commonly referred to as forever-lasting and usually associated with the idea of memories, friendships, relationships, and nostalgia. By using an original, vintage-looking Polaroid photo for the front cover, with Lyn's signature right across the image, this design not only gives a quick emphasis on the artist's name (which is incredibly important for a front cover for fans' recognition), but also establishes the general theme throughout the digipak and the entire album itself. "Handwritten" font is a large size to draw attention to the album title (another crucial element to the front cover), is used to give further sustenance to the concept - a little messy, "out of place", yet incredibly fitting and chic. 
Regarding the subject, in this case, Lyn, should look a little carefree, almost aloof, and unaware of the camera capturing her. The goal is to build the look of "the candid girlfriend" - a trending theme on TikTok and Instagram, where a girl who is effortlessly pretty in unposed, candid photos. It is the natural, unbothered, and most significantly, authentic element that should successfully sell the idea of a close-to-her-audience yet bright artist. 



2. BACK COVER

Influenced by Billie Eilish and Lana Del Rey's digipak, on which I have done thorough research and analysis, the back cover is kept quite simple, mostly focusing on the names of the tracks of the album, bar codes (for sale-tracking purposes at retail stores), and the credits - record labels, other studios or partners involved, etc. Moreover, another major reason why I thought of having the back cover without too many details is to "shine light" upon the photoshoots, which will be done for the marketing campaign for Lyn across multiple platforms. This back cover will bring a different vibe to the front cover, presenting how Lyn can adapt herself to different concepts and still thrive - a flexibility that is highly expected by the viewers in the media nowadays. It still holds a sense of sophistication and gentleness that are Lyn's main values, yet here she brings another side of her character to the market, where her maturity and sharp features are highlighted. 




3. INNER CONTENT

    a) The CD: To contrast the highly detailed sketches I made on the 2 extra spreads on the sides of the placement of the, I balanced the view by creating the CD with a low amount of images and/or designs, keeping it plain yet informative and visually appealing using diverse fonts (from cursive to more vintage with various sizes). The idea of the curved line surrounding the CD was derived from the "Hit Me Hard and Soft" digipak by Billie Eilish; I thought it gave the CD more shape, making it more interesting to observe. 

    b) The extra sleeves: I included 3 main pictures, or subjects: flowers, an eye, and a deer. 

The flower is there to represent the authenticity that is Lyn as a singer, songwriter. Lilies are authentic because they exist exactly as they are, without trying to be anything else. The beauty of a flower isn't manufactured or mediated to look less imperfect and refined, but it is raw and honest => represents fully what Lyn's image stands for, especially in terms of "enhancing one's own beauty and features. 

The deer, with wide eyes and a gentle presence, experiences life with optimism and purity - mirroring a teen's early understanding of society and its way of operating. The image of the creature is the representation of how Lyn upholds her innocence from those teenage years, while fostering a sense of bravery in facing the hardships that are certainly coming her way as she enters a new chapter of life - adulthood, like a deer making its way into the deep and scary forest everyday once it's old enough to be on its own. This detail reinforces the relatable aspect of Lyn's identity, aligning her with all the teenagers facing the same change, not only in age, but also in responsiblity, in social networking, as well as mentality. 

Lastly, the eye. "Eyes are window into the soul," said by all the poets, writers, or even journalists. They reflect the truth, or in Al Pacino's words "The eyes, chico, they never lie." Basically, the eye is the visual representation of Lyn's true identity, one even Lyn is yet to be able to fully see herself, one that is existing but developing, learning from mistakes as Lyn's career progresses. Having the eye within the digipak is similar to sending invitations to all Lyn's supporters to join her on the journey of finding her own, real self, and encouraging them to do the same for themselves. 

Apart from the personal imageries and subjects, I also made sure to include some more conventional things from an inner parts of a digipak, to ensure the "look" of the product: song lyrics and titles.
